The Spider (Al-Ankaboot)
In the name of God, The Most Gracious, The Dispenser of Grace
۞ Alif-Lam-Mim. 1 Do people think they will not be tested because they say, "We have faith?" 2 We indeed tested those before them – so Allah will surely test the truthful, and will surely test the liars. 3 Do the evil-doers think they can escape Us? How terrible is their judgment? 4 Whoso looks to encounter God, God's term is coming; He is the All-hearing, the All-knowing. 5 And if any strive (with might and main), they do so for their own souls: for Allah is free of all needs from all creation. 6 We shall pardon the sinful deeds of those who believe and do the right, and give them a reward better than their deeds. 7 We have charged man, that he be kind to his parents; but if they strive with thee to make thee associate with Me that whereof thou hast no knowledge, then do not obey them; unto Me you shall return, and I shall tell you what you were doing. 8 And those who believe and do righteous deeds - We will surely admit them among the righteous [into Paradise]. 9 Some people say, "We have faith in God." But when they face some hardship for His cause, they begin to consider the persecution that they have experienced from people as a torment from God. When your Lord grants you a victory, they say, "We were with you." Does God not know best what is in the hearts of every creature? 10 Verily Allah knoweth those who believe, and verily He knoweth the hypocrites. 11 Those who deny say to those who affirm: "Follow our way; we shall carry the burden of your sins." But they cannot carry the burden of their sins in the least. They are liars indeed. 12 Yet most certainly will they have to bear their own burdens, and other burdens besides their own; and most certainly will they be called to account on Resurrection Day for all their false assertions! 13
